What should I consider when choosing a cybersecurity course?

There are many types of cyber security courses, from short courses to long-term programs. Here are some things to consider when choosing the right one. These are some ideas to consider:

  • What level certification would you prefer? Some courses give certificates upon successful completion. Others award diplomas or degrees. Certificates are often easier to obtain, but diplomas and degrees are generally considered more prestigious.
  • How many weeks/months would you need to complete the course. Courses typically last 6-12 weeks. Some courses may take longer.
  • Do you prefer face–to-face interaction over distance learning? Face-to-face courses are great for getting to know other students, but they can be expensive. Distance learning allows you the freedom to work at your pace and avoids travel costs.
  • Are you looking to change your career or simply refresh your knowledge? Career changers who already hold a job in another field may find that a short course is enough to refresh their knowledge and help them gain new skills. Others might simply want to refresh their knowledge before applying for a job.
  • Is it accredited? Accreditation assures that a course's reliability and credibility. Accreditation guarantees that your money will not be wasted on courses that do not deliver the results you expected.
  • Do you offer internships or other placements as part of the course? Internships allow you to apply what you've learned during the class and get real-world experience working with IT professionals. Placements offer you the chance to learn from cybersecurity experts and get valuable hands-on experience.

How do you become a cyber security expert?

Cybersecurity is one field that is experiencing rapid growth. To protect businesses from online threats, cybersecurity specialists are essential as more companies adopt cloud computing, big-data analytics, mobility options, virtualization, and other technologies.

There are two types:

  1. Penetration testers (Penetration testers) - A penetration test uses advanced hacking techniques for identifying vulnerabilities in the network infrastructure.
  2. Network administrators - A network administrator configures firewalls, switches and routers to manage networks.

To become a cybersecurity specialist, you need to have a solid understanding of both these subjects. These are some suggestions to help you become an expert in cybersecurity:

  1. Understanding network architecture design and construction is the first step in becoming a cybersecurity expert. Learn about TCP/IP protocols. Learn about wireless networks, VPNs and cloud computing as well as VoIP, cloud computing and other emerging technologies.
  2. Learn computer systems and their applications. Next, you will need to learn programming languages like C++, Python PHP, ASP.NET and JavaScript. Learn operating systems like Linux and Windows Server 2012 R2, Unix as well as Mac OS X and iOS. Understanding enterprise software, mobile apps, web-based services, and databases is the final step.
  3. Your tools are yours: Once you're proficient in programming and operating various computer systems, you can make your own tools. These tools can be used to monitor, secure, and test the computers and networks of an organization.
  4. Get certified: To earn the title of a cybersecurity expert, you should get certified. Look for certification programs offered by professional organizations via LinkedIn. There are many examples: CompTIA Advanced Security Practitioner (CAP), Certified Ethical Hacker (CEH), and SANS Institute GIAC.
  5. You can build a portfolio once you have the technical knowledge and experience. This portfolio will help you get a job as a cybersecurity professional. You might also consider working as a freelancer.
  6. Join industry associations: Joining industry associations will allow you to connect with other cybersecurity experts and make valuable contacts. For example, you can join the Information Systems Audit and Control Association.
  7. Finally, you should look for opportunities. There are many IT consulting firms and information technology service providers that offer cybersecurity roles.
